When you need a hand around the house, the final bill depends on a few straightforward things. First, it comes down to the scope of the project—whether we are handling a quick repair or a multi-day installation. The cost of materials is another factor, as higher-end supplies will naturally increase the budget. We also look at the accessibility of the work area and the overall complexity of the task. If you have several small jobs bundled together, that can sometimes save on travel time compared to individual visits. We keep it simple and transparent. Some handymen are cross-trained to handle basic plumbing repairs alongside general carpentry. You need this service for simple issues like replacing a toilet flapper, installing a new sink faucet, or fixing a minor pipe drip under a vanity. If the work requires extensive piping or permits, a licensed plumber may be necessary.
A handyman typically handles a variety of home repair and maintenance tasks that don't necessarily require a specialized contractor. This includes things like fixing minor plumbing issues, patching drywall, painting, assembling furniture, and performing general carpentry. Be cautious if a handyman pressures you for full payment upfront, lacks proper identification, or can't provide references. Unclear pricing or an unwillingness to offer a written estimate are also warning signs.
